Transport Options

Traveling from Calden to Berlin offers several convenient options. The quickest method is by flight, with direct flights taking around 1 hour, though you’ll need to factor in airport transfers and security checks. For a more scenic route, consider the train, which takes approximately 3 to 4 hours and provides a comfortable experience with beautiful views of the countryside. If you prefer flexibility, driving offers a travel time of about 3 to 4 hours, making it ideal for families or groups wanting to explore along the way. Buses are also available, taking around 4 to 5 hours, and are a budget-friendly option for solo travelers. Each mode of transport caters to different needs, ensuring you can find the best fit for your journey.
